ParticipantSteering wheel wobble at 80kph and a weird floaty feeling on the highway, is this just a tyre balance thing or something deeper?
I’ve got a 2018 Pajero that I’ve been driving for about two years now and it’s been pretty bulletproof honestly but over the last month or so I’ve started picking up this vibration through the steering wheel that comes in right around 80 to 90 kilometers an hour and then kind of smooths out a bit after that, and at the same time the whole truck feels like it’s wallowing over dips on the E311 in a way that I don’t remember it doing before, almost like it takes an extra second to settle after a bump and the rear end feels a bit disconnected from the front. I had the tyres balanced at a little shop in Satwa because I figured that was the obvious culprit and it helped for about three days before the shimmy came right back, and now I’m starting to wonder if I’m actually looking at the early signs of worn 4×4 suspension system instead of just a simple tyre issue, especially with the way the nose dives forward when I brake for the lights near City Walk. A friend of mine who’s had a few off roaders over the years said it might be the control arm bushings or even the steering rack mounts getting sloppy from all the heat cycles and the weight of the vehicle, and he sent me over to that thedubaiweb site to have a read through what typical SUV issues look like in this part of the world. I guess I’m just trying to figure out if I should start budgeting for a proper suspension refresh before the weather cools down and everyone floods the garages for the same reason.
